Stage 1 - Initial consultation

Our tutor will come to your home to meet both the student and a parent.  They will look at the learning space in the home, determine the needs of the student through open and honest discussion, and devise a plan to move forward.  After this consultation, the tutor will share this plan with the family and all parties can decide if they wish to progress to the next stage.

Stage 2 - 4 week programme

Over a 4 week period, the tutor will work through the agreed plan, delivering key study skills tips, and setting and reviewing targets for the student through a virtual weekly meeting lasting 45 minutes.  At the end of the meeting, the tutor will produce a report for parents, reviewing progress and detailing expectations for the forthcoming week.  On week 4 of this process, the tutor will meet vitually with both the student and parent to review outcomes.  At this point the objective may have been reached and the programme ends or both parties may wish to proceed for a further 4 weeks.

Careers advice

Set up a one to one meeting with a careers advisor based in your community with an understanding of pathways open to both year 11 and year 13 students.  Our advisors are fully familiar with the UCAS process and can help year 13  students navigate the process and make informed decisions.  For those students who do not wish to go to university, they are aware of apprenticeship opportunities open to students.  They are also fully aware of the local offer for year 11 students and can help with the transition to Key Stage 5.
